Bugs

       Basic files are not handled properly.

Description

kc2raw converts the following file types to KC memory dumps. Those files only represent a memory snapshot
       without any header.

       1) files used by the KC emulator by Arne Fitzenreiter (usually named .TAP)

       2)  files  used  by  the  GEMINI-SOFT KC emulator (usually named .GPF for machine code files and .GBF for
       basic files)

       3) BASIC files (usually named .SSS)

       4) KC image files that contain the data written by the KC tape routines without block number and checksum
       (usually named .KCC or .KCB where the .KCB files are BASIC files with an autostart routine)

Name

       kc2raw - convert KC files to KC memory dumps

See Also

kcemu(1x), kctape(1), kc2tap(1), kc2wav(1), kc2img(1)

Synopsis

kc2raw<infile><outfile>
